The last_reset_cause is a plain old BGP_MAX_PACKET_SIZE buffer
that is really enlarging the peer data structure. Let's just
copy the stream that failed and only allocate how ever much
the packet size actually was. While it's likely that we have
a reset reason, the packet typically is not going to be 65k
in size. Let's save space.

Consider this scenario:
Lots of peers with a bunch of route information that is changing
fast. One of the peers happens to be really slow for whatever
reason. The way the output queue is filled is that bgpd puts
64 packets at a time and then reschedules itself to send more
in the future. Now suppose that peer has hit it's input Queue
limit and is slow. As such bgp will continue to add data to
the output Queue, irrelevant if the other side is receiving
this data.
Let's limit the Output Queue to the same limit as the Input
Queue. This should prevent bgp eating up large amounts of
memory as stream data when under severe network trauma.

See the BGP message sequence:
R1 R2
| updates |
|------------------>|
| |
| refresh request |
x<------------------|
| |
| updates cont. |
|------------------>|
| |
| end-of-rib |
|------------------>|
| |
When R1 and R2 establish BGP session, R1 begins to send initial updates.
If R2 sends a route-refresh request before EoR, it's silently ignored
by R1, and routes received earlier have no chance to be processed again.
RFC7313 says, "for a BGP speaker that supports the BGP Graceful Restart,
it MUST NOT send a BoRR for an <AFI, SAFI> to a neighbor before it sends
the EoR for the <AFI, SAFI> to the neighbor." But it doesn't forbid
route-refresh request to be sent before receiving EoR.
To handle this scenario, postpone response to refresh request until EoR
is sent.

The "bgp_notify_" apis in bgp_packet.c generate a notification
to a peer, usually during error handling. The io pthread wants
to send notifications in a couple of cases during early
received-packet validation - but the existing api interacts
with the peer struct itself, and that's not safe.
Add a new api for use by the io pthread, and adjust the main
notify api so that it can avoid touching the peer struct.

If we receive CEASE Notification or HOLDTIME notification, retain STALE
routes if it's not a CEASE/Hard Reset.
When doing `clear ip bgp PEER`, we can control if this would be CEASE/Hard Reset
or not by using `bgp hard-administrative-reset` knob.
When `bgp graceful-restart notification` is disabled, STALE routes won't be
retained when receiving Notification message.
